)]}' { "commit": "c6c021f95760ee137cbdc2d0e137c2897447e0a7", "tree": "3cb3234f88e19fffb0366ad661a900f5b0adb930", "parents": [ "ee561d3968df009a9d1a0e084527e80627dc3657" ], "author": { "name": "Tom Sepez", "email": "tsepez@chromium.org", "time": "Thu Dec 06 21:37:49 2018 +0000" }, "committer": { "name": "Chromium commit bot", "email": "commit-bot@chromium.org", "time": "Thu Dec 06 21:37:49 2018 +0000" }, "message": "XFA: generate value tables with C preprocessor.\n\nEnsure several tables stay in sync with each other in face of\nadditions.\n\nChange-Id: I76610104cf64a8043e7741065781821d2091238b\nReviewed-on: https://pdfium-review.googlesource.com/c/46651\nReviewed-by: Lei Zhang \u003cthestig@chromium.org\u003e\nCommit-Queue: Tom Sepez \u003ctsepez@chromium.org\u003e\n", "tree_diff": [ { "type": "modify", "old_id": "9198caad522bb3659813bf781262d79049ca3209", "old_mode": 33188, "old_path": "xfa/fxfa/fxfa_basic.h", "new_id": "267448e47a37e46f2230a62165732b73e560c887", "new_mode": 33188, "new_path": "xfa/fxfa/fxfa_basic.h" }, { "type": "modify", "old_id": "e4da266223091b4d95404c974a63f1df9c88c4e6", "old_mode": 33188, "old_path": "xfa/fxfa/fxfa_basic_unittest.cpp", "new_id": "7462b048cf42c557d078f5a108ce6a36019846b3", "new_mode": 33188, "new_path": "xfa/fxfa/fxfa_basic_unittest.cpp" }, { "type": "add", "old_id": "0000000000000000000000000000000000000000", "old_mode": 0, "old_path": "/dev/null", "new_id": "6cfdadff6c5007a20eb7e07179cae67a270342e3", "new_mode": 33188, "new_path": "xfa/fxfa/parser/attribute_values.inc" }, { "type": "modify", "old_id": "dac21ddf955c5bcdf6e1e97431893375df2db29b", "old_mode": 33188, "old_path": "xfa/fxfa/parser/xfa_basic_data_enum.cpp", "new_id": "7f931929c0a8d7de72cc2d2f6817aea50123a6a6", "new_mode": 33188, "new_path": "xfa/fxfa/parser/xfa_basic_data_enum.cpp" } ] }